Wario


Wario (ワリオ?) is a fictional character in Nintendo's Mario series who was designed as an antagonist to Mario. He first appeared in the 1992 Game Boy title Super Mario Land 2: 6 Golden Coins as the main antagonist and final boss. He was portrayed as an exaggerated version of Mario and his name is a variant of "Mario". Wario was first designed by Hiroji Kiyotake, and is voiced by Charles Martinet, who also voices many other characters in the series.

Red Pikmin


Red Pikmin are the first variety of Pikmin identified in the Pikmin games. Aside from their color, the distinguishing feature of Red Pikmin is their pointed noses. These Pikmin possess an immunity to fire, making them useful for fighting Fiery Bulblaxes and Fiery Blowhogs and passing by - or, in Pikmin 2, destroying - fire geysers. In Super Smash Bros. Brawl, Red Pikmin can also use fire to attack their opponents.

The hands are very hard. One way to bypass this problem is cutting hand shaped patterns out of colored paper or coloring white paper red with markers. But to make them look the best, using the pieces is recommended. If you would like to make the leaf double sided, print the first page twice. Other than that, this is a very simple model.

Wheelie



Wheelie is a tire-shaped enemy that is currently one of the few sources of the Wheel ability. He resembles a tire with two eyes, and sometimes has bright red covering over his top half. In the games they speed right into Kirby. In Kirby Air Ride, Wheelie appears both as the classic enemy and a souped-up Wheelie Bike version, which Kirby can ride. Wheelie also appears as a scooter like vehicle known as the Wheelie Scooter and a bigger machine called the Rex Wheelie

Ice Flower


Ice flowers are found in the New Super Mario Bros. game for the Wii. They are similar to Fire Flowers but instead they shoot ice balls. Ice Flowers can do damage to Dry Bones unlike Fire Flowers.
